Crafthouse developed a robot called Melissa that has five human-like fingers. It can impressively fold and open just as a real human hand can. This sophisticated humanoid robot utilizes servomotors and a feedback mechanism system to help it do the task.
Though Melissa looks like a small devilish robot from the movie “Transformers”, it can shake one’s hand and can throw a ball. One setback though is that it cannot make a dirty sign with its middle finger.
This 34cm robot is equipped with a yaw axis and an arm axis making it possible to make almost human-like movements. Because of its shorter leg size, the Melissa robot has a lower center of gravity, making it possible for this humanoid robot to stabilize it walking.
